Summary
T-cell receptor (TCR) expression levels change dynamically during immune responses. T cells maintain signaling capacity through mechanisms regulating TCR quantity and quality, crucial for immune regulation.

Main Results:
- Surface TCR expression undergoes significant changes but T cells sustain signaling capacity.
- Mechanisms involve controlling TCR quantity and quality, with TCR signaling as a key modulator.
- Antigenic stimulation strength tunes TCR upregulation, and distinct TCR forms may exist.
Conclusions:
- TCR expression and signaling are dynamically regulated through quantitative and qualitative mechanisms.
- These modulations are critical for sustained T-cell signaling and immune response regulation.
